Abstract :
Service composition becomes more and more popular in enterprise application, and the Business Process Execution Language (BPEL) has become the de facto standard for Web service composition. However, web services usually communicate over internet connections that are not highly reliable, so a large amount of effort in the development of a business process is spent on fault handling. What makes things worse is the static nature of BPEL. To address those problems, we propose a strategy-based fault handling mechanism for composite service providing user-defined fault handling strategy. This mechanism allows designer to separate the fault handling logic from the business logic and add new fault handling strategies without terminating the process instance. We also design a BPEL engine to support this mechanism.
